Barren County, KY

Housing costs in Barren?
A typical home costs $166,000, which is 50.9% less exp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 14.6% less expensive than the average Kentucky home, at $194,300.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Barren costs $740 per month, which is 48.3% cheaper than the national average of $1,430 and 24.3% cheaper than the state average of $920.

Can I afford Barren?
To live comfortably in Barren Kentu County, Kentucky, a minimum annual income of $31,680 for a family, and $22,800 for a single person is recommended.
